An expert system that provides fault detection and limited fault tolerance was designed for a generic aircraft model. A best-first search among applicable rules was utilized, leading to efficient recognition and processing of abnormal situations. Results showed that such an expert system is feasible and that it could contribute to increased reliability of aircraft system operation without a high degree of complexity.
